The Moab Music Festival is a cherished event that brings together families, couples, pet lovers, and friends to celebrate music amidst the stunning red rock landscapes of Moab, Utah. From September 2 to September 18, 2026, this festival offers a unique blend of world-class performances and outdoor adventures, creating unforgettable memories for all ages.
Set against the backdrop of Moab’s iconic red rock formations and the serene Colorado River, the festival’s venues include the Colorado River Wilderness Grotto, Easy Bee Farm, Red Cliffs Lodge, and various wilderness locations. These settings provide a harmonious blend of music and nature, inviting attendees to experience the beauty of the American West.
The festival features a diverse lineup of performances, including chamber music, jazz, and Latin music, with concerts held at various venues such as the Moab Arts and Recreation Center and Star Hall. Attendees can also enjoy musical raft trips down the Colorado River, guided hikes, and stargazing bonfires, offering a range of activities that cater to families, pet owners, couples, and large groups.
